关闭框时重定向用户

时间:2014-01-26 01:32:58

标签: html popup

我有一个javascript弹出上下文菜单,下面有一个按钮,关闭。按下该按钮将继续到下一页。如果用户不单击关闭按钮并决定在弹出框外单击,则不会重定向用户。如果用户在框外单击它将重定向它们而不单击框内的关闭按钮,我可以添加javascript函数。使用osx-modal-content插件

如何触发*

<input type='button' name='osx' value='Click Here To Enter The Website!' class='osx demo'/></a>

插件页面(链接)

OSX STYLE DIALOG ** OSX STYLE DIALOG ** OSX STYLE DIALOG **

http://www.ericmmartin.com/projects/simplemodal-demos/

这是关闭函数的原因**

close: function (d) {
    var self = this; // this = SimpleModal object
    d.container.animate(
        {top:"-" + (d.container.height() + 20)},
        500,
        function () {
            self.close(); // or $.modal.close();
        }

1 个答案:

答案 0 :(得分:0)

这就是关闭你的方法:

$("#element-id").modal({
      onClose: function () {
          window.location.href = "http://stackoverflow.com";
     }
});

如果您添加了一个元素:

// Load dialog on click
$('#basic-modal .basic').click(function (e) {
    $('#basic-modal-content').modal();

    return false;
});

将其更改为

// Load dialog on click
$('#basic-modal .basic').click(function (e) {
    $('#basic-modal-content').modal({
          onClose: function () {
              window.location.href = "http://stackoverflow.com";
         }
    });
    return false;
});